Output ec8e7ae2b95d25b27cbdd19d58a5443481fa4618a62405eb7870f646112ca1df:23

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d0c655cf33961346f5fcfa1b8e693e66f2cdbc512edb85eb7da25ee279d6f12
address
bc1pf5xx2h8n89sngm6le7sm3e5nuehjek79ztkmsh4hmgj7ufuadufq0zamsk
transaction
ec8e7ae2b95d25b27cbdd19d58a5443481fa4618a62405eb7870f646112ca1df
spent
true